Hello everyone.

I just bought a Pajero V6 3.0 6G72. Im having problems now with the fluctuating idle. I have cleaned the throttle body, idle speed controller, air flow sensor(just after the air cleaner). changed spark plugs,changed fuel filter, changed air hose, adjusted engine timing to specs. and still im getting fluctuations on my idling. i even have it diagnosed at the dealer with their Mut-1 or Mut 2 but to no avail.

what could be my problem?

Can anyone please help me???

Aldee check the big air hose from the air cleaner to the throttle body for leaks. If its cracked or has small holes it'll mess with the idle. If you have a spare just swap it out. If thats not the case, check you O2 sensor, sometimes it has a faulty connection.

Also check to see if your EGR valve is stuck open / plugged with carbon build-up. That can cause an erratic idle.
